#301168 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#301168 is composed of 18.8% red, 6.7%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.8% cyan, 83.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 261.4 degrees, a saturation of 71.9% and a lightness of 23.7%. #301168 color hex could be obtained by blending #6022d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#301168
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010003 is the darkest color, while #f5f1f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#301168
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3c3b3e is the less saturated color, while #2c0376 is the most saturated one.
